ACR+ Member North London Waste Authority will be holding its first ever London Upcycling Show, on 30 November 2016 at Walthamstow Assembly Hall.

Many activities will be organized during the event, including upcycling demonstrations, workshops and a range of exhibitors, providing advice and ideas as well as selling upcycled items, and gourmet canapés made from surplus food will be prepared.

Winners for the north London upcycling competition will also be announced. Residents, families or community groups were invited to upcycle a piece of furniture to be in with a chance to win £200 vouchers.

The Upcycling Show is organised as part of European Week for Waste Reduction (EWWR) 2016. If you are also developing an action for the EWWR this year and would like to see it promoted in the Newsline, contact ACR+ Secretariat.

Each year, many ACR+ Members get involved in the EWWR through the organisation of action on waste reduction. For the 2016 edition, 9 ACR+ Members also took on the role of national and regional EWWR Coordinators: ARC, Bamee, Brussels Environment, LIPOR, Residuos do Nordeste, Wallonia, Waste Serv Malta, WRAP Northen Ireland and Zero Waste Scotland.
